Will Retail Employees Sell Out Their Employers?

According to a recent CareerBuilder.com survey, it appears retail workers will jump ship just as hiring steps up.

Fact  #291:   21 percent of retail workers plan to change job in the fourth quarter of 2004. (Source: CareerBuilder.com)

Fact  #292:   49 percent of retail hiring managers say they’ll add workers to their staffs by the end of 2004.  (Source: CareerBuilder.com)

Fact  #293;   50 percent of retail workers say they’re upset with their pay and have not received a raise this year.. (Source: CareerBuilder.com)

Fact  #294:   62 percent of those polled said their workloads have increased in the last six months. (Source: CareerBuilder.com)

Fact  #295:  44 percent of retail workers say they’re being asked to do too much. (Source: CareerBuilder.com)
